Male‐Specific Coliphage (MSC)• Virus which infect coliform bacteria• Enteric virus surrogate • Cultureable using rapid, inexpensive techniques

• Non‐virulent • 25‐30nm icosahedral capsid• Single stranded RNA genome• Chlorine resistant• More resistant to environmental stresses than fecal coliforms

Page 3: MSC in the NSSP · Chapter IV. Shellstock Growing Areas @.03 Growing Area Classification. A.General. Each growing area shall be correctly classified as approved, conditionally approved,

Male‐Specific Coliphage EcologyRaw Sewage  104‐5 PFU/100ml

Treated Sewage 102‐3 PFU/100ml

Animal Sources Horses, hogs, chickens

• 1700 horses to equal a 1 MGD WWTP

National Shellfish Sanitation Program (NSSP)

• Established in 1925 by the Surgeon General in response to widespread typhoid fever outbreaks

• Control measures to ensure safe shellfish• Cooperative program: FDA, States, Industry

• 1984 MOU recognizing the Interstate Shellfish Sanitation Conference as the primary organization of State Regulatory Officials

When Can MSC Be Used?• Chapter IV @.03 A.(5)(c)

(ii) For emergency closures (not applicable for conditional closures) of harvest areas caused by the occurrence of raw untreated sewage discharged from a large community sewage collection system or wastewater treatment plant, the analytical sample results shall not exceed background levels or a level of fifty (50) male‐specific coliphage per 100 grams from shellfish samples collected no sooner than seven (7) days after contamination has ceased and from representative locations in each growing area potentially impacted;

Summary of WWTP Efficiency Use

When a conditional management plan around a WWTP is developed, MSC would more accurately define viral pathogens reduction efficiency of the plant than the bacterial fecal indicators.

FDA/State Shoreline Surveys

• East Greenwich, RI‐ cross connections• Empire, LA‐ failing septic tanks• Bristol, RI‐ overflowing manhole in woods• Pawcatuck River, RI‐ cross‐connections• Coos Bay, OR‐ 62 shoreline sources; <10 MSC• Morro Bay, CA‐ very little shoreline contribution• Tomales Bay, CA‐ Possible seeps from evaporation pond and failing septic tanks

• Bay St. Louis, MS‐ failing lift station and malfunctioning air‐trap

Summary of Shoreline Survey Use

Shoreline surveys are very large investment in time and money.   Get more bang for your buck, by adding a column of data on the spreadsheet.   

Indicator profiles will suggest where mitigation should occur to prevent municipal sewage from entering into the watershed.
